Invoking Yell

Invoking Yell (2023)

  • Runtime

    1h 24m

  • Language

    ES

  • Production Countries

    Chile

  • Release Date

    2023-08-22

Overview

Set in 1990s story of three twenty something women who venture into the woods to shoot a demo tape for their black metal band.

Media

Similar